Global Trade Services – Jurisdiction & Classification Service Center, Change Management Lead

We are building a world class Global Trade Services (GTS) organization, which includes Operational Service Centers focused on critical trade services. This new role leads the Classification Change activities within the Trade Jurisdiction & Classification Operational Service Center (OSC), which is responsible for supporting centralized core activities to assess and manage jurisdiction and classification determinations for export and import in all locations where TE operates.

 

This role will be responsible for assisting the Director in leading the Trade Jurisdiction & Classification OSC, delivering oversight and management of change requests and activities and implementing process control for the entire Service Center while delivering change management plans and impact assessments for the jurisdiction and classification for import and export jurisdiction and classification assessments to support TE's operations worldwide. Key responsibilities relate to leading Jurisdiction & Classification activities in the relevant jurisdictions and working with the Director to implement strategy development, program design and execution, personnel management and training, and systems deployment and optimization. The role reports to the Director of the Jurisdiction & Classification Service Center, joining a team of global trade professionals who are passionate about ensuring the future growth of the business by providing business solutions for compliance with global trade laws and regulations.
